seamless communication
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"seamless communication"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a smooth and uninterrupted exchange of information between individuals or systems. Example: "The new software update has greatly improved our team's ability to maintain seamless communication, even when working remotely."

Linguistic Context
The phrase "seamless communication" functions as a noun phrase where 'seamless' acts as an adjective modifying the noun 'communication'. It describes a type of communication characterized by its smoothness and lack of disruption. As evidenced by Ludwig, the phrase is often used to describe technological systems or organizational processes.

More alternative expressions(6)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
uninterrupted communication
Emphasizes the continuous nature of the communication, removing breaks or pauses.
flawless communication
Highlights the absence of errors or imperfections in the communication process.
smooth communication
Focuses on the ease and lack of friction in the exchange of information.
integrated communication
Suggests that different communication channels or systems are working together effectively.
fluid communication
Implies a natural and effortless flow of information.
harmonious communication
Stresses the agreement and collaboration aspect in the interaction.
cohesive communication
Focuses on the unity and consistency of the message being conveyed.
efficient communication
Highlights the productivity and resourcefulness of the communication process.
effective communication
Underscores the success in conveying a message and achieving a desired outcome.
transparent communication
Stresses the openness and honesty in the exchange of information.
FAQs
How can I ensure "seamless communication" in a remote team?
Establish clear communication protocols, use collaborative tools for document sharing and project management, and schedule regular virtual meetings to maintain connection and address any issues promptly. Consider alternatives like "uninterrupted communication" as well.
What are the key elements of "seamless communication" in customer service?
Providing consistent information across all channels, offering personalized support, and ensuring smooth transitions between different agents or departments. Alternatives include striving for "flawless communication" and "smooth communication".
How does "seamless communication" contribute to project success?
It ensures that all team members are aligned on goals, tasks, and deadlines, reducing the risk of errors, delays, and conflicts. Consider aiming for alternatives such as "integrated communication".
What is the difference between "seamless communication" and "effective communication"?
"Seamless communication" focuses on the effortless and uninterrupted flow of information, while effective communication emphasizes the successful transmission and understanding of a message. You might also aim for "fluid communication" or "harmonious communication".
